The 2014 Louisiana Tech Bulldogs football team represented Louisiana Tech University in the 2014 NCAA Division I FBS football season. They were led by second-year head coach Skip Holtz and played their home games at Joe Aillet Stadium in Ruston, Louisiana. They were in their second season as a member of Conference USA, competing in the West Division. They finished the season 9–5, 7–1 in C-USA play to win the West Division title. As West Division Champions, they played East Division Champion Marshall in the C-USA Championship Game, losing to the Thundering Herd 23–26. They were invited to the Heart of Dallas Bowl where they defeated Illinois.
